Comments on the reserve resource information

  • RESERVES ARE ESTIMATED AT 667 ST PER VERTICAL FOOT AND CONTAIN 1.35% BERYL.

Comments on development

  • IN 1955, PITS AND TRENCHES WERE DUG AND THERE WAS SOME DRILLING. PROPERTY WAS DRILLED AGAIN IN 1969-1970. IN 1972, THERE WAS BULK SAMPLING AND BENEFICIATION TESTS.
